What is the FSA Debit Card Application?
The FSA Debit Card Application allows individuals to manage out-of-pocket medical expenses efficiently. This healthcare debit card simplifies payment for eligible medical costs, providing ease of use directly at healthcare providers and retail stores. Understanding the application process is vital to securing this valuable tool for financial management of medical expenses.
Eligible expenses generally include items such as copays, prescriptions, and certain over-the-counter medications. To benefit from this flexibility, users must navigate the application process correctly, ensuring all necessary documentation is provided.
Purpose and Benefits of the FSA Debit Card
The FSA debit card is designed to make the payment process for medical expenses straightforward. One of its primary benefits is the potential for tax savings, as funds used from the flexible spending account are often not subject to income tax.
This medical expense card enhances convenience by allowing users to settle bills seamlessly at various healthcare providers and stores, making managing multiple expenditures easier. By simplifying expenses, it supports families in effectively managing their healthcare needs.
Who Needs the FSA Debit Card Application?
This application is essential for employees enrolled in employer-sponsored flexible spending accounts (FSAs). Additionally, dependents that meet certain criteria can also benefit from having an FSA debit card.
Families managing multiple medical expenses will find this card particularly advantageous, as it enables a collective approach to healthcare expenditures, catering to the needs of all family members.
Eligibility Criteria for the FSA Debit Card
To qualify for an FSA debit card, applicants must meet specific eligibility criteria set forth by their employer’s program. This can include having an active flexible spending account and providing proof of medical-related expenses.
Documentation may be necessary to validate eligibility, which can vary depending on employer-specific regulations, so applicants should review these requirements carefully before applying.

Who is eligible to apply for the FSA Debit Card?
Individuals eligible for the FSA Debit Card must have an active Flexible Spending Account. This typically includes employees participating in employer-sponsored healthcare plans or those with qualifying dependents.
Are there any deadlines for submitting the FSA Debit Card Application?
While specific deadlines may vary by employer or plan, it’s advisable to submit the FSA Debit Card Application as soon as possible to ensure timely access to funds for medical expenses.
How do I submit the FSA Debit Card Application once completed?
You can submit the FSA Debit Card Application either electronically through pdfFiller by following the submission prompts or by printing and mailing it to the specified address provided by your employer.
What supporting documents are required with the application?
Typically, additional documentation is not required with the FSA Debit Card Application. However, you may need to provide proof of eligibility or medical expenses during usage, so keep relevant records handy.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include not signing the application, omitting required fields, and providing incorrect personal information. Double-checking your entries helps avoid these issues and ensures a smooth application process.
How long does processing of the FSA Debit Card Application take?
Processing times can vary, but applications are typically reviewed within a few business days. You will be notified once your application has been approved or if further information is needed.
What should I do if I have issues using my FSA debit card?
If you encounter issues using your FSA debit card, contact your FSA plan administrator for assistance. They can provide guidance and help resolve any problems related to your card usage.
